Blackburn care home enjoys harvest celebrationsCelebrations were in order at HC-One’s Old Gates care home as Residents and Colleagues recently held their harvest festival in the home.

Children from the local primary school joined Residents in creating harvest crafts and salt dough, which everyone found to be so exciting as they made their own creations.

Everyone chatted amongst one another as they enjoyed a buffet lunch and well-deserved break before continuing their activities together. 

Relatives and friends also attended the home for an afternoon of 1950s music alongside tea and cake, which ended the day nicely for all.

Helen Holden, Home Manager, commented : “Such an exciting day was had by all. It was lovely to see the children happily enjoying themselves and engaging with our Residents in the home.”
